To qualify for certification, record providers had to ask for certification and pay for an independent audit in their publications to validate that a offered record experienced in actual fact sold the requisite quantities.

Regarding how they have been made, right up until about 1985 nickel "stamper" or "mother" discs were being employed. The nickel stamper disc was thinly plated in serious gold for Gold awards and left bare for Platinum awards due to their normal silver or "platinum" coloration.
